Atlanta, GA (October 30, 2022) – A significant two-car incident occurred on a major street in Atlanta, Georgia, at about 10:15 p.m. on Sunday.
The incident happened between Ashford Dunwoody Road and Dunwoody on the right side of westbound Interstate 285, according to local agencies, including the Atlanta Police Department.
At least two people were injured and sent to the hospital, although the exact number of persons affected is unclear at this time.
Due to a car fire, emergency services had to limit numerous highways temporarily. According to what was made publicly available by authorities, the appropriate authorities are currently conducting investigations.
